Enterprise data warehouse to a cloud-native analytics platform on AWS + Snowflake. We are looking for a Senior/Lead Data Engineer to design and build reliable ingestion and ELT pipelines, dimensional data models, and production-ready operational controls..
Candidates must have strong Snowflake hands-on delivery e.g. Snowpipe / Tasks / Streams, dimensional modelling, performance tuning, and operational readiness.
we are also open to strong enterprise DW engineers (Oracle / other cloud DW) with solid SQL and modelling fundamentals who can ramp up quickly on Snowflake.
The key is proven end-to-end delivery experience and track record, and the ability to build reliable, production-ready pipelines.
Key Responsibilities
Design and build data pipelines and data warehouse layers in Snowflake (e.g., RAW/ODS/DW schemas, tables, views).
Implement ingestion and orchestration using Snowflake features such as Stages/Storage Integrations, Snow pipe, Tasks/Streams, Stored Procedures (or equivalent agreed patterns).
Develop and maintain dimensional models (facts/dimensions), including transformations, aggregates, and performance optimization.
Implement data quality checks, reconciliation, and validation to ensure correctness and consistency.
Hands-on experience building on Snowflake (or strong cloud DW experience with solid ability to ramp up on Snowflake quickly).
Good understanding of dimensional modelling (fact/dimension design).
Experience with cloud data integration patterns (e.g., S3 or similar object storage) and production pipeline practices (logging, retries, operational support) Plus Points (Advantage)